    Sciatica is discomfort that begins in your lower back and shoots down through your legs and often into your feet. It happens when something in your body-- maybe a herniated disk or bone spur compresses your sciatic nerve. Some people experience sharp, extreme discomfort, and others get tingling, weak point, and feeling numb in their legs.

    The majority of people with sciatica do not wind up needing surgery, and about half get better within 6 weeks with just rest and medication. Many individuals believe that alternative treatments like yoga, massage, biofeedback, and acupuncture aid with sciatica. Yourfirst choice must be over-the-counter painkiller. Acetaminophen and NSAIDs( n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drugs) like aspirin, ibuprofen, and naproxen are really helpful, however you should not utilize them for extended periods without talking toyour medical professional. Tricyclic antidepressants such as amitriptyline( Elavil )and anti- seizure medications sometimes work, too.

    Steroid injections straight into the irritated nerve can likewise provide you with restricted relief. Whenall else fails, surgery is the last resort for about 5% to 10% of individuals with sciatica. If you have milder sciatica but are still in discomfort after 3 months of resting, stretching, and taking medication, you and your doctor probably will have to speak about surgical treatment. That's a straight-to-surgery circumstance. The two primary surgical alternatives for sciatica are diskectomy and laminectomy - sciatica pain treatment. During this procedureyour surgeon eliminates whatever is pressing on your sciatic nerve, whether it's a herniated disk, a bone spur, or something else. The goal is to remove only the piece that's actually triggering the sciatica, however often cosmetic surgeons have to get rid of the entire disk to fix the problem.
